"Global Elite Urged to Tax Extreme Wealth by High-Net Worth Individuals at Davos"

Nearly 270 millionaires and billionaires attending The World Economic Forum in Davos have signed a letter urging world leaders to tax their wealth, warning of catastrophic consequences if economic inequality is not addressed. They argue that taxing extreme wealth will not significantly impact their standard of living and is necessary to prevent further societal degradation. A new poll shows that a majority of wealthy individuals support higher taxes on their fortunes, with 75% backing a 2% tax on billionaires. The call for action comes amid growing concerns about worsening inequality, with the world's richest seeing their fortunes double while the poorest 60% became poorer.
